Which type of waves is considered the least dangerous on the electromagnetic spectrum?

The least dangerous type of waves on the electromagnetic spectrum is represented by TV waves. This classification primarily stems from their longer wavelengths and lower energy compared to other options listed.

TV waves, which are a form of radio waves, have wavelengths that can range from about 1 meter to 100 kilometers. This lower energy means that they do not possess the ability to ionize atoms or molecules, which is a characteristic of more harmful types of radiation such as X-rays, gamma rays, or UV rays. Ionizing radiation poses risks because it can remove tightly bound electrons from atoms, potentially leading to cellular damage and increased cancer risk.

In contrast, X-rays and gamma rays have much shorter wavelengths and higher energy levels, making them capable of penetrating materials and causing ionization. UV rays also have the potential to cause damage to skin cells and DNA. Thus, the presence of ionization capability is what categorizes these other forms of radiation as more dangerous.

In summary, TV waves are considered the least dangerous on the electromagnetic spectrum due to their relatively low energy and non-ionizing nature, distinguishing them from the more harmful radiation types.
